Abstract: |
This report presents the results of an archaeological magnetometer survey completed for the Friends of Berry Castle as part of an ongoing programme of research and conservation. Three anomaly groups, present on all sides of the monument, were characterised as representing an outer ditch, a stony element of the ramparts on the outer side and an earthen element of the ramparts on the inner side. A previously identified potential entrance on the western side of the monument was assessed most likely to be a true entrance. The magnetic anomaly group representing an earthen element of the ramparts on the inner side at two other potential entrances was continuous which implied that they were not entrances or that the structure of ramparts underwent later changes. A third previously identified potential entrance on the eastern side was discounted. An alternative entrance sited centrally on the eastern side was identified, again with reservations. Potential inner divisions were mapped that mirrored the main ramparts in shape and a potential charcoal production platform was tentatively identified. Two linear anomalies representing potential archaeological deposits were identified to the west of the monument but not characterised further. Anomalies representing possible agricultural terraces were identified to the south of the monument. No conclusions were reached about a previously mapped surface deposit of stones to the southwest. Linear anomaly groups representing stony and earthen deposits were identified to the east that may represent previously recorded earthworks external to the main monument. |
